Tesamorelin vs Sermorelin

Tesamorelin and Sermorelin are two GHRH analogs, so the comparison is within one family — both prompt the pituitary via the GHRH receptor. The difference is stability and research focus: Sermorelin closely mimics native GHRH with a very short action, while Tesamorelin is stabilised and carries a visceral-fat literature.

What is the difference between Tesamorelin and Sermorelin?

Both are GHRH analogs. Sermorelin is a GHRH(1-29) analog that closely mimics native GHRH with a very short half-life; Tesamorelin is a stabilised analog with a longer action and a distinctive visceral-fat literature. Same pathway, different stability and focus.

Which is more stable?

Tesamorelin is the stabilised analog with a longer half-life, whereas Sermorelin mimics the brief kinetics of native GHRH. Tesamorelin is supplied for research purposes only.
